1. The document discusses ways that churches can become more environmentally friendly or "green" in their worship, fellowship, buildings and grounds, outreach, habits, education, and advocacy. It provides many specific project ideas that churches have implemented in these areas. 2. The Bible establishes that humans are called to care for and protect God's creation. The Christian Reformed Church has also acknowledged this calling in official statements. 3. Churches are encouraged to start becoming more green by completing a self-assessment, forming a study group, and beginning with small changes at home and in their congregations. Resources and support are available online.
